As you likely know, MLRC is holding a double-header weekend on June 25-26.
Saturday will be the RallySprint. It is shaping up very well – the course is all set and it is looking like we will have at least 7 entries, which is the best yet as we grow this new aspect of rally.
For the competitors Registration opens at 9 AM and Recce will start at 9:30. Competition will begin at 12 noon and will finish by 4 PM. We should be able to have the workers fill in their spots as the Recce is going on with a bit of coordination over the radio, so if workers arrive by 10 AM we should be able to work it out.
The RallySprint is running on part of the Egan Creek complex. HQ will be at TC27 (junction of the main Egan Rd & Crooked Trail). From there the stages will run as follows – a small section on the main Egan Creek Rd from TC28 down to TC 29 (junction of Birch Lake Trail), then across Birch Lake Trail to TC33 (Mayo Lake Rd) then north on Mayo Lake Rd to just below RC151 (Browns Ln). It is broken into two stages of about 5 km length. Then they drive those two stages in reverse, go back to HQ for Service and repeat all that again for a total of just a bit under 40 km of stages.
Worker needs is less for RallySprint than for a regular rally. We will need 3-4 people at each stage end. Total of about 25-30 workers for everything. Timing will be much simpler than for a rally – just a watch for Starts and electronic shadow clock (no beams) at the Flying Finishes.
Sunday will be the RallyCross. Schedule and worker needs are as usual for that.
